It’s a simple thing, yet seldom offered. Representative Linda Upmeyer included a link to a survey she is conducting ahead of the 2020 legislative session in her most recent newsletter.

Upmeyer is asking Iowans for their thoughts on some specific issues. Other than the obvious positive of being able to provide feedback, another benefit to surveys like this is they provide a little hint of what House Republicans may be thinking they’ll do in 2020.

“The upcoming session is shaping up to be a busy one,” Upmeyer wrote. “As we prepare to gavel in, I want to know what you are thinking about some of the most pressing challenges and opportunities our state faces.”

Upmeyer does a good job of asking a few open-ended questions too so Iowans can bring up their own issues.
